Hello,

It is very easy to have a polygon with a NULL attribute field but is it possible to have a polygon feature class and have a feature with NULL geometry?  I would like to do this without the complexity of a versioned database or a related table? 

This would be useful for parcel data when a parcel ID is retired - for example when two adjacent parcels are amalgamated and one or both parcel ID's are retired and replaced by a new parcel ID.  Our parcel data is managed by our Land Registry Office.  We receive daily copies of the parcel data as a simple polygon featrue class but it only includes all of the active parcel IDs.  Many government services reference the parcel ID.  It is a problem when someone tries to search our parcel map service with a retired parcel ID.  There is no way for our service to indicate the user is searching for a retired parcel ID.

Does anyone have a suggestion?

Thanks,

Bernie.

Select your record(s) and Field Calculate (Python)

SHAPE=

 

None

 

but.. I'd really recommend your archive everything properly and have an archiving process set up/defined before you start doing this.  It strongly suggest you just use another field to filter/definition query your data instead, as when the geometry is gone, it's gone.  But in a simple answer to your question, the above should work.
